包兰线粉质粘土路基填筑试验分析

摘  要:液塑限含水率高、塑性指数大是粉质粘土所具有的特点。当粉质粘土用于北方地区铁路路基时,其压实质量对将来防止冻胀病害的发生以及路基的不均匀沉降起着至关重要的作用。针对包兰线的粉质粘土用于铁路路基时进行的填筑工艺试验,对碾压机械、填料的含水率、虚铺厚度、碾压工艺等参数进行了试验分析。结果表明,现场施工时的最佳含水率要求接近填料的最优含水率,当超过最优含水率较多时难以压实;合理的虚铺厚度为30~35 cm;26T压路机吨位过大,不宜用于粉质粘土路基的填筑碾压,对于20 T压路机,合理的碾压工艺为1静+1弱+4~5强+1静;当填土的碾压质量较差时,K30值的应力—沉降量曲线形状呈"S"形。Sihy clay is characterized by high liquid-plastic-limit moisture content and big plasticity index. The compaction of silty clay plays an important role in preventing the occurrence of frost heaving and differential settlement of subgrade when it is used in Northern Region. Filling technology experiments were carried on to silty clay embankment for the railway of Baotou-Lanzhou line;what's more, the parameters of compacting machineries,the moisture content of filler,filling thickness, and rolling technique were analyzed and tested. The results show that the best moisture content is required close to the best moisture content of filler on the construction site. It is ditficult to compact when the former exceeds the later. A reasonable filling thickness should be within 30 - 35 cm. The tonnage of 26 T road roller is too large to be used to fill and roll silty clay subgrade. As for 20 T road rollers, the reasonable rolling technology should be 1 stillness + lweakness +4 -5 forte + lstillness. The curve shape of the stress-settlement of K30is shaped as "S" when rolling quality of rilled earth is worse.
